What work you'll be responsible for: 
  • Review of international tax compliance forms and working with a dedicated international tax team 

  • Prepare analysis and computations for Subpart F, GILTI, PFIC, PTEP, and FTC, including §962 elections and treaty-based positions 

  • Collaborate with the Private Client Services and Trust & Estate groups on cross-border matters for individuals and families with global holdings and activities 

  • Develop tax planning opportunities arising from inbound and outbound cross-border transactions and activities 

  • Develop models illustrating individuals' cross-border tax attributes, foreign tax credit positions, and overall US tax exposure 

  • Manage day-to-day interactions with clients and ensure the completion of both tax compliance and advisory projects 

  • Supervise and train staff 

  • Share relevant tax thought leadership and draft tax alerts 

  • Stay current with Tax Reform and comprehend the new regulations and rulings 

Basic qualifications: 
  • 8+ years of experience in international tax compliance and/or planning 

  • CPA, JD, or EA 

  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ited college/university 

  • Experience reviewing Forms 1040 and 1040-NR that typically include foreign filing attachments and pass-through K-1/K-3 reporting 

  • 1+ years of supervisory experience 

Preferred Qualifications: 
  • Experience using OIT, GoSystems and/or CCH Axcess tax software 

  • Knowledge of individual and/or partnership taxation 

  • Fundamental knowledge of a broad range of US international tax rules and provisions, including Subpart F, GILTI, FTC, PFICs, WHT, FIRPTA, PTI, expatriation (§877A), and the foreign trust and foreign gift regimes 

  • Comprehensive understanding of international tax reporting obligations, including Forms 1040-NR, 1116, 5471, 8865, 8858, 8621, 8938, 8992, 3520, 3520-A, 8854, 8833, and FinCEN Form 114 (FBAR) 

  • Experience with RIA Checkpoint and BNA

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
